2020-01-10efi: Allow disabling PCI busmastering on bridges during bootMatthew Garrett
Add an option to disable the busmaster bit in the control register on all PCI bridges before calling ExitBootServices() and passing control to the runtime kernel. System firmware may configure the IOMMU to prevent malicious PCI devices from being able to attack the OS via DMA. However, since firmware can't guarantee that the OS is IOMMU-aware, it will tear down IOMMU configuration when ExitBootServices() is called. This leaves a window between where a hostile device could still cause damage before Linux configures the IOMMU again. If CONFIG_EFI_DISABLE_PCI_DMA is enabled or "efi=disable_early_pci_dma" is passed on the command line, the EFI stub will clear the busmaster bit on all PCI bridges before ExitBootServices() is called. This will prevent any malicious PCI devices from being able to perform DMA until the kernel reenables busmastering after configuring the IOMMU. This option may cause failures with some poorly behaved hardware and should not be enabled without testing. The kernel commandline options "efi=disable_early_pci_dma" or "efi=no_disable_early_pci_dma" may be used to override the default. Note that PCI devices downstream from PCI bridges are disconnected from their drivers first, using the UEFI driver model API, so that DMA can be disabled safely at the bridge level. 2020-01-10efi/x86: Allow translating 64-bit arguments for mixed mode callsArvind Sankar
Introduce the ability to define macros to perform argument translation for the calls that need it, and define them for the boot services that we currently use. When calling 32-bit firmware methods in mixed mode, all output parameters that are 32-bit according to the firmware, but 64-bit in the kernel (ie OUT UINTN * or OUT VOID **) must be initialized in the kernel, or the upper 32 bits may contain garbage. Define macros that zero out the upper 32 bits of the output before invoking the firmware method. When a 32-bit EFI call takes 64-bit arguments, the mixed-mode call must push the two 32-bit halves as separate arguments onto the stack. This can be achieved by splitting the argument into its two halves when calling the assembler thunk. Define a macro to do this for the free_pages boot service. 2019-12-30drivers: firmware: scmi: Extend SCMI transport layer by trace eventsLukasz Luba
The SCMI transport layer communicates via mailboxes and shared memory with firmware running on a microcontroller. It is platform specific how long it takes to pass a SCMI message. The most sensitive requests are coming from CPUFreq subsystem, which might be used by the scheduler. Thus, there is a need to measure these delays and capture anomalies. This change introduces trace events wrapped around transfer code. According to Jim's suggestion a unique transfer_id is to distinguish similar entries which might have the same message id, protocol id and sequence. This is a case then there are some timeouts in transfers. 2019-12-25efi/libstub: Rename efi_call_early/_runtime macros to be more intuitiveArd Biesheuvel
The macros efi_call_early and efi_call_runtime are used to call EFI boot services and runtime services, respectively. However, the naming is confusing, given that the early vs runtime distinction may suggest that these are used for calling the same set of services either early or late (== at runtime), while in reality, the sets of services they can be used with are completely disjoint, and efi_call_runtime is also only usable in 'early' code. So do a global sweep to replace all occurrences with efi_bs_call or efi_rt_call, respectively, where BS and RT match the idiom used by the UEFI spec to refer to boot time or runtime services. While at it, use 'func' as the macro parameter name for the function pointers, which is less likely to collide and cause weird build errors. 2019-12-25efi/libstub/x86: Work around page freeing issue in mixed modeArd Biesheuvel
Mixed mode translates calls from the 64-bit kernel into the 32-bit firmware by wrapping them in a call to a thunking routine that pushes a 32-bit word onto the stack for each argument passed to the function, regardless of the argument type. This works surprisingly well for most services and protocols, with the exception of ones that take explicit 64-bit arguments. efi_free() invokes the FreePages() EFI boot service, which takes a efi_physical_addr_t as its address argument, and this is one of those 64-bit types. This means that the 32-bit firmware will interpret the (addr, size) pair as a single 64-bit quantity, and since it is guaranteed to have the high word set (as size > 0), it will always fail due to the fact that EFI memory allocations are always < 4 GB on 32-bit firmware. So let's fix this by giving the thunking code a little hand, and pass two values for the address, and a third one for the size.
